Danbury Weather: What to Expect Year-Round

Danbury experiences a humid continental climate, featuring snowy winters and warm summers, making spring and fall the ideal seasons for visiting. Be prepared for varying conditions, as weather can influence outdoor activities and sightseeing opportunities.

There is no direct link between Worcester and Danbury. However, there are options to travel between the two cities. The train journey takes approximately 6 hours and 8 minutes with transfers in Springfield, New Haven, and South Norwalk. If you prefer a bus, the journey takes the same amount of time with transfers in Bridgeport Transportation Center and Wheels Hub. Alternatively, driving by car takes around 2 hours and 6 minutes.
